Verda Elementary School is a higher-need, mid-sized combined-grade school in Montgomery, Louisiana, enrolling 308 students.
Class loads run somewhat heavier than typical: 18.1:1 puts it in the larger third of Louisiana schools by student-teacher ratio.
Economic need runs somewhat above the state's typical profile, with 73.8% of students eligible for free meals.
Enrollment of 308 puts it in the smaller third of Louisiana schools by headcount.
Its Resource Investment Index sits near the middle of the pack among 1,330 scored Louisiana schools.
Against 312 statewide peers matched on enrollment and economic need, it ranks mid-pack at #170.
Its student body is led by White (67%) and African American (25%) (diversity index 48/100).
Attendance holds up well here: only 7.1% of students were chronically absent, below the typical post-pandemic national figure.
